The Department of Food & Supplies, Government of West Bengal has launched a dedicated WhatsApp chatbot to make it easier for the citizens of the State to apply for a ration card, lodge grievances and get access to other critical resources. The chatbot also helps farmers with verified information pertaining to paddy related procurement. The bot is free to use and is available in English and Bengali.
The chatbot aims to help 10 crore-plus beneficiaries of ration cards in the state of West Bengal. “The chatbot is built with full service capabilities and eliminates the need for people to visit the ration office in person to get their queries addressed or submit requests. The bot is easy to use and is built with resources such as ration card application forms, tracking application, linking to AADHAR, guidance on scheduling sale of paddy, etc,” said the company in a statement.
How to access the WhatsApp bot
To access the bot, WhatsApp users need to simply send ‘Hi’ to the number https://wa.me/919903055505/.
